Output 73de503a6055c10b8cf4a9caf64b88d74f3a72f3cb02d2d26e4da93dc4a1a5b5:4

value
1674937
script pubkey
OP_0 OP_PUSHBYTES_20 7ab521652c5287a5c206bbf80ad242089b761e4c
address
bc1q026jzefv22r6tssxh0uq45jzpzdhv8jvheqxfh
transaction
73de503a6055c10b8cf4a9caf64b88d74f3a72f3cb02d2d26e4da93dc4a1a5b5
confirmations
263861
spent
true